首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php源码一键建站

基础概念

PHP源码一键建站是指使用预编写的PHP代码模板,通过简单的配置和操作,快速搭建一个功能齐全的网站。这种建站方式通常包括数据库配置、页面布局、功能模块等,旨在简化建站流程,提高开发效率。

相关优势

  1. 快速部署:用户只需上传源码并配置数据库,即可快速搭建网站。
  2. 成本低:相比定制开发,使用源码建站可以节省大量的时间和人力成本。
  3. 易于维护:源码通常有详细的文档和社区支持,便于后期维护和更新。
  4. 灵活性高:用户可以根据需求选择不同的模板和插件,实现个性化定制。

类型

  1. CMS(内容管理系统):如WordPress、Drupal等,提供丰富的功能和插件,适合内容驱动的网站。
  2. 电商平台:如Magento、WooCommerce等,适用于在线购物网站。
  3. 社交网络:如Elgg、BuddyPress等,适用于构建社区和社交平台。
  4. 企业网站:如Joomla、PrestaShop等,适用于企业官网和在线商店。

应用场景

  1. 个人博客:使用CMS模板快速搭建个人博客,分享文章和心得。
  2. 电商网站:搭建在线商店,销售商品和服务。
  3. 企业官网:展示企业信息、产品和服务,提升品牌形象。
  4. 社交平台:构建社区,提供用户交流和互动的平台。

常见问题及解决方法

问题1:源码上传后无法正常运行

原因:可能是文件权限设置不当、数据库配置错误或依赖库缺失。

解决方法

  1. 检查文件权限,确保PHP文件和目录有正确的读写权限。
  2. 核对数据库配置文件(如config.php),确保数据库连接信息正确。
  3. 确保所有依赖库已正确安装,可以通过Composer等工具管理依赖。

问题2:网站运行缓慢或出现500错误

原因:可能是服务器配置不足、代码优化不当或数据库查询效率低。

解决方法

  1. 检查服务器配置,确保有足够的资源(如CPU、内存)。
  2. 优化PHP代码,减少不必要的计算和数据库查询。
  3. 使用缓存技术(如Redis、Memcached)提高数据访问速度。

问题3:安全问题

原因:可能是源码存在漏洞,或者服务器配置不当。

解决方法

  1. 定期更新源码和依赖库,修复已知的安全漏洞。
  2. 配置服务器防火墙,限制不必要的网络访问。
  3. 使用HTTPS加密传输数据,保护用户隐私。

示例代码

以下是一个简单的PHP源码示例,用于搭建一个基本的个人博客:

代码语言:txt
复制
<?php
// 数据库连接
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"blog";

$conn = new mysqli($servername, $username, $password, $dbname);

if ($conn->connect_error) {
    die("连接失败: " . $conn->connect_error);
}

// 查询博客文章
$sql = "SELECT id, title, content FROM posts";
$result = $conn->query($sql);

if ($result->num_rows > 0) {
    while($row = $result->fetch_assoc()) {
        echo "<h2>" . $row["title"] . "</h2>";
        echo "<p>" . $row["content"] . "</p>";
    }
} else {
    echo "没有结果";
}
$conn->close();
?>

参考链接

通过以上信息,您可以快速了解PHP源码一键建站的基础概念、优势、类型、应用场景以及常见问题及解决方法。希望这些信息对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券